Any ideas why a ’93 Chim wont stay below 95c with heater off even driving at 50mph, but runs at 85~90, never going over 90 even sitting in traffic with the heater on.
Have recently had a rad recore and a head gasket test.
Is it likely to be…
Thermostat not fully opening
Water pump getting old
Partly blocked heater by pass

….or all of the above

My '94 Chim has a similar characteristic. With the heater control to cold and no fan, the normal running temperature has often gone above the 90 mark, but stable. In traffic, I often turn the control to Red and this will reduce the temp quite quickly, and with the fan on will stabilise below 90 on the hottest days in traffic.

Bit hot in the car though!

With a new otter switch (the old one shorted and kept the fans on), different temp range, the temperature has stayed below 90, with the lever nearer cold than hot.

I don't think the temp values are very accurate, so if the characteristic hasn't suddenly changed, there's probably not much to be concerned about.
